Holistic Sleep Aids for People: Do They Work?
Many adults struggle with problems falling asleep or remaining restful read more sleep, often looking for alternatives to prescription sleep medication. Numerous natural sleep remedies, such as chamomile tea, L-theanine supplements, and zinc products, are marketed as effective ways to support deeper sleep. While some research suggests possible benefit from these techniques, the typical evidence base is frequently small. Basically, their effectiveness can change significantly depending on the root of the insomnia and personal factors. It's essential to discuss a medical practitioner before trying any natural sleep aid, particularly if you have existing health problems or are taking other supplements.

Problems Resting?: Mature Slumber Remedy Options
Are you dealing with frequent problems falling asleep? Many grown-ups have with rest issues in today’s hectic world. Fortunately, there are solutions to manage this common problem. Consider exploring these practical rest improvement approaches:
- Implementing a regular sleep schedule.
- Optimizing your bedroom environment – ensuring it's dim and cool.
- Adding calming practices like meditation.
- Checking your eating habits and avoiding stimulants and liquor close to bedtime.
- Consulting a physician to investigate possible sleep disorders.
Keep in mind that finding the best solution could necessitate some experimentation. Focusing on your slumber is essential for general health and performance.
